Sometimes when you receive an email attachments with some unknown extension that is not allowed on email client, at that time you may face problem in opening those attachments. this is because these kind attachments can spread computer viruses and malware easily through email messages. Below are the list of attachment extension that are not allowed over email client. .ad, .adp, .crt, .ins, .mdb, .mde, .msc, .msp, .sct, .shb, .vb, .wsc, .wsf, .cpl, .shs, .vsd, .vst, .vss, .vsw, .asp, .bas, .bat, .chm, .cmd, .com, .exe, .hlp, .hta, .inf, .isp, .js, .jse, .lnk, .msi, .mst, .pcd, .pif, .reg, .scr, .url, .vbe, .vbs, .ws, and .wsh.
